Shanxi province's agricultural production saw strong results in 2022, according to the Shanxi Statistics Bureau. 

The annual grain growing area was 31,503.33 square kilometers, an increase of 0.4 percent year-on-year, while the total annual grain output was 14.64 million metric tons, an increase of 3.0 percent over the previous year.

The province expanded the scale of protected agriculture by accelerating the reconstruction of old greenhouses, building standardized industrial parks for vegetable greenhouses, promoting intelligent technology in facilities and equipment and transplanting technology of large seedlings, developing vegetable products, and expanding the edible fungus industry. 

In 2022, the vegetable-growing area in the province was 2,306.67 sq km, an increase of 6.7 percent year-on-year, while the output of vegetables and edible fungi was 10.42 million tons, up 6.7 percent year-on-year.

Shanxi began work on a project to improve the quality and efficiency of fruit production last year by promoting the construction of high-standard orchards, the integrated technology of fruit tree planting, and the planting of new varieties.

The fruit output in 2022 was 10.18 million tons, an increase of 4.4 percent over the previous year.

The province's animal husbandry production showed rapid growth over the past year. 

The annual output of pork, beef, mutton and poultry reached 1.43 million tons, up 6.0 percent year-on-year, while the output of eggs and milk respectively increased 4.5 percent and 5.7 percent year-on-year to 1.18 million tons and 1.43 million tons.

In addition, Shanxi generated 221.90 billion yuan ($32.86 billion) in output value and 141.54 billion yuan in added value in the agriculture, forestry, animal husbandry and fishing industries, up 5.3 percent and 5.1 percent year-on-year, respectively.
